wvl Posts: 14

Why are people having trouble with bmconv.exe?

Just google for the file and download it.

Next you need to know how many frames (pics) an MBM contains. You can find this on:

http://my-symbian.com/uiq/faq/showquestion.php?fldAuto=7&faq=2

Use something like this to extract the bitmaps:
bmconv.exe /u file.mbm outputbitmap-1.bmp outputbitmap-2.bmp

..and a similar command to combine them back to an MBM file (don't forget to specify the color depth! just place "/c24") such as:

bmconv.exe /u file.mbm /c24inputbitmap-1.bmp /c24inputbitmap-2.bmp

Note that I could be slightly off on the synax (I can't check at the moment).

For the Linux people: it's works perfectly under wine.
